As we draw closer to the 2022 Texas governor race, more names are popping up to challenge current Governor Greg Abott.  One possible opponent could be actor Mathew McConaughey.

One of the presumed frontrunners for the Texas Democratic ticket is thought to be former United States Representative Beto O’Rourke.  According to recent polling, there could be another challenger approaching.

Spectrum Local News reported “actor Mathew McConaughey leads in a hypothetical matchup against current Texas governor Greg Abott.” 

While a celebrity running for political office isn’t new, the thought of McConaughey as the leading man in Texas politics may come by surprise to some.  For anyone who has followed Texas politics closely, they’ll know that Mathew McConaughey has expressed some interest in going into a leadership role for awhile. 

“What I’ve gotta choose for myself is, I want to get into a leadership role in the next chapter of my life. Now, what role am I gonna be most useful in? I don’t know that that’s in a political position.” McConaughey said in an interview on the Today Show last March.

More recently, the actor appeared on an episode of the podcast “Set it straight: Myths and Legends.” “I’m measuring it,” McConaughey said. “Look, it’s going to be in some capacity. … I just — I’m more of a folksy and philosopher poet statesman than I am a, per se, definitive politician. So I go, well, that’s a reason not to, but then I go, no, that’s exactly why you should, because politics needs redefinition, but I’m measuring, you know, what is my category? What’s my embassy?”

As the presumed frontrunner, O’Rourke has not said much about his potential rival.  “I don’t know anything about his potential run other than what I’ve read,” O’Rourke said in an interview with The New York Times. 

However, O’Rourke said he is a fan of McConaughey’s acting and is impressed by the effort he has made to help fellow Texans.  McConaughey hosted the “We’re Texas” virtual fundraising event in February of this year to help those affected by the record-breaking cold weather.
